Releases: akhilannan/pbir-utils
Releases · akhilannan/pbir-utils
pbir-utils 0.6.0
New Function
sanitize_powerbi_report
: A comprehensive Power BI report sanitization utility designed to clean up and optimize Power BI reports.
Cleanup Actions
- Remove unused measures
- Clean up unused bookmarks
- Remove unused custom visuals
- Disable "Show items with no data"
- Hide tooltip and drillthrough pages
- Set the first page as active
- Remove empty pages
- Remove hidden visuals never shown
- Clean up invalid bookmarks
Key Benefits
- Reduces report file size
- Improves report performance
- Cleans up unused and hidden elements
- Provides granular control over report cleanup
Usage
Refer to example_usage.ipynb for detailed usage instructions and examples of the report sanitization function.
pbir-utils 0.5.4
Improvements:
Report Wireframe page sorting corrected.
pbir-utils 0.5.3
New Functions:
- update_report_filters: Enables bulk updating of report-level filters in the Power BI filter pane.
- sort_report_filters: Allows custom sorting of report-level filter pane attributes.
Improvements:
Added type annotations to all function parameters.
pbir-utils 0.5.2
New Functions:
- update_report_filters: Enables bulk updating of report-level filters in the Power BI filter pane.
- sort_report_filters: Allows custom sorting of report-level filter pane attributes.
Improvements:
Added type annotations to all function parameters.
pbir-utils 0.5.1
New Functions:
- update_report_filters: Enables bulk updating of report-level filters in the Power BI filter pane.
- sort_report_filters: Allows custom sorting of report-level filter pane attributes.
Improvements:
Added type annotations to all function parameters.
pbir-utils 0.5.0
New Functions:
pbir-utils 0.4.8
Updated Function:
- export_pbir_metadata_to_csv: Added a filter parameter to allow filtering on any column in the final output.
pbir-utils 0.4.7
Renamed Function:
- get_measure_dependencies renamed to generate_measure_dependencies_report
pbir-utils 0.4.6
Renamed Function:
- get_measure_dependencies renamed to generate_measure_dependencies_report
pbir-utils 0.4.0
Improvements
- New Function:
- get_measure_dependencies: Gets the dependency tree for given measures or all measures in a Power BI report, optionally including visual IDs.
- Updated Function:
- remove_measures: check_visual_usage flag now checks usage in dependant measures as well.